Mpumi Drops New Single “Ukhalelani” Featuring DJ Active as She Teases Upcoming EP

South African songstress Mpumi is back with a powerful new single titled “Ukhalelani,” featuring the dynamic DJ Active, and it’s already creating a buzz among fans of Afro-house and soulful music. The release comes as a taste of what’s to come, with Mpumi confirming that a full EP is on the way.
“Ukhalelani,” which translates to “Why are you crying?” in isiZulu, is a deeply emotive track that blends Mpumi’s rich vocals with DJ Active’s vibrant production. The song speaks to themes of resilience, healing, and standing strong in the face of hardship—messages that have consistently resonated throughout Mpumi’s career.
Backed by a pulsating beat and layered harmonies, “Ukhalelani” is both a dancefloor anthem and a reflective experience. DJ Active’s polished touch on the production brings a modern energy to the song, while Mpumi’s unmistakable voice and lyrical storytelling ground it in emotional authenticity.
Mpumi, who has become a household name in South Africa’s house music scene through hits like “Somandla” and “Yehla Moya,” has once again proven her staying power. Her ability to fuse spirituality, culture, and groove makes her music not just enjoyable, but meaningful.
Fans won’t have to wait too long for more music. In a recent social media update, Mpumi revealed that a new EP is currently in the works, and “Ukhalelani” is just the beginning. Though the official release date for the EP hasn’t been announced, excitement is building as listeners anticipate a full project that continues her legacy of heartfelt, high-quality Afro-house music.
With “Ukhalelani,” Mpumi reaffirms her place as one of South Africa’s most respected vocalists. The collaboration with DJ Active highlights her versatility and willingness to evolve while staying true to her roots.
